Your role in the team
- You will gather and maintain an overview over our operational FIS system landscape
- You put a focus on ensuring system stability, availability and performance
- You support with troubleshooting during incidents and root-cause analysis thereafter
- You assist our engineering and application developer teams in creating and monitoring their relevant KPIs to fulfill our SLAs
- You advise our developer teams on their setups and with transition to production
- You translate technical insights into proposals for adapting our architecture
- You support our teams on their way to migrate applications into the cloud
- You engineer automated development procedures
- You automate system tasks
- You develop base features in the general area of FIS

Hapag-Lloyd AG
Hapag-Lloyd is one of the leading shipping companies in the world. The company has around 13,000 employees and 392 branches in 129 countries. Hapag-Lloyd has a container capacity of about 2.5 million TEU - including one of the largest and most modern fleets of reefer containers.
